Plant ID in the Wild: Essential Skills for Nature Lovers

For those who cherish the wonders of nature, being able to recognize plants can dramatically enrich your outdoor experiences. Whether you're a budding botanist or simply someone who enjoys taking walks in the woods, learning how to pinpoint the diverse vegetation around you opens up a whole new aspect of understanding and appreciation. From medicinal herbs to poisonous types, each plant holds unique characteristics that can be explored through keen observation and knowledge of botanical characteristics.

  • Begin your journey by focusing on the fundamentals. Look at a plant's shape, size, and shade – these are often helpful indicators.
  • Pay close attention to the leaves, as they can be incredibly specific. Consider their arrangement on the stem, their borders, and any unique markings or textures.
  • Explore the plant's blooms if they are present. Note their quantity, structure, and hue. These details can be crucial for recognition

Employ field guides, apps, or online resources to compare your observations with known plants. Remember, practice makes perfect! The more you interact yourself in the world of plant recognition, the more confident and knowledgeable you will become.
